Disregarding Correct Slope



Appropriate incline is vital for a reliable gutter system, as it straight affects water drainage effectiveness. A properly designed gutter needs to have a minor slope, commonly around 1/4 inch for every 10 feet of size, routing water toward the downspouts. Failure to develop this incline can result in water pooling in sections of the seamless gutter, raising the risk of overflow, obstructions, and eventual damage to the structure.


Additionally, inappropriate slope can intensify deterioration on the seamless gutter products, leading to premature failure and costly repairs. Property owners might locate that water waterfalls over the edge during heavy rainfall, producing prospective dangers around the structure and landscaping. Furthermore, stagnant water can become a breeding ground for pests and might encourage mold development.

Missing Supports and Hangers





A sturdy rain gutter system counts greatly on using supports and wall mounts, which are important for preserving architectural stability and efficient water flow. Overlooking these elements can bring about drooping gutters, resulting in incorrect drain and prospective water damages to your home.




Supports and wall mounts need to be mounted at ideal periods, typically every 2 to 3 feet, depending on the gutter size and material. This ensures that the weight of the ice, water, and particles does not endanger the seamless gutter's capability. Missing these crucial components can develop stress and anxiety factors in the system, causing leaks and premature wear.


Furthermore, the choice of materials for hangers and assistances need to not be neglected. Selecting sturdy, corrosion-resistant products will certainly improve the longevity of the rain gutter system. Plastic might appear affordable however can damage in time, while steel sustains deal improved stamina and strength.

Overlooking Downspout Positioning



Efficient downspout placement is an important aspect of you can try these out rain gutter installment that is often neglected, yet it plays a considerable duty in ensuring optimal drainage. Correctly positioned downspouts direct water away from the foundation of the home, avoiding prospective water damages or disintegration. A typical error is to install downspouts too close to the foundation, which can lead to water pooling and increased risk of structural problems.


Additionally, the number and area of downspouts must be strategically planned based on the roof size and incline. Not enough downspout positioning can trigger rain gutters to overflow during hefty rainfall, resulting in water cascading over the edges and possibly destructive landscape design or home siding - Gutter Installation in Strongsville. It is a good idea to put downspouts at intervals that permit ample water circulation, commonly every 30 to 40 feet of seamless gutter size


Downspouts need to be directed in the direction of water drainage systems or away from the residence to boost water circulation performance. In recap, thorough planning of downspout placement is essential for reliable water management and the long-lasting longevity of the gutter system.
